GT Biopharma (NASDAQ:GTBP) Trading 5.1% Higher – Still a Buy?

GT Biopharma, Inc. (NASDAQ:GTBPGet Free Report) shot up 5.1% during mid-day trading on Monday . The company traded as high as $0.3156 and last traded at $0.3086. 418,806 shares traded hands during trading, a decline of 46% from the average session volume of 780,414 shares. The stock had previously closed at $0.2935.

GT Biopharma Price Performance

The stock has a market cap of $14.08 million, a price-to-earnings ratio of -0.05 and a beta of 0.90. The firm’s 50-day moving average is $0.42 and its 200 day moving average is $0.45.

GT Biopharma (NASDAQ:GTBPGet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ings results on Friday, May 15th. The company reported ($0.11) earnings per share for the quarter, missing analysts’ consensus estimates of ($0.08) by ($0.03). On average, sell-side analysts forecast that GT Biopharma, Inc. will post -0.34 EPS for the current year.

GT Biopharma, Inc is a clinical-stage biopharmaceutical company dedicated to developing novel immuno-oncology therapies utilizing its proprietary Tri-specific NK cell engager (TriKE) platform. This technology is designed to harness and enhance the body’s natural killer (NK) cells by simultaneously binding tumor antigens and interleukin-15 (IL-15), stimulating NK cell proliferation and targeted cytotoxicity. By focusing on NK cell engagement rather than T-cell activation, the company aims to offer therapies with potentially improved safety profiles and reduced immune-related adverse events.

The company’s lead candidate, GTB-3550, is currently in clinical trials for hematologic malignancies such as acute myeloid leukemia (AML), chronic lymphocytic leukemia (CLL) and myelodysplastic syndromes (MDS).
